Geekbench 5 Benchmarks
Intel Core i7-980X | vs | Intel Core i7-7700T |
---|---|---|
Mar 16th, 2010 | Release Date | Jan 3rd, 2017 |
Core i7 | Collection | Core i7 |
Gulftown | Codename | Kaby Lake |
Intel Socket 1366 | Socket | Intel Socket 1151 |
Desktop | Segment | Desktop |
6 | Cores | 4 |
12 | Threads | 8 |
3.3 GHz | Base Clock Speed | 2.9 GHz |
3.6 GHz | Turbo Clock Speed | 3.8 GHz |
130 W | TDP | 35 W |
32 nm | Process Size | 14 nm |
25.0x | Multiplier | 29.0x |
None | Integrated Graphics | HD 630 |
Yes | Overclockable | No |
